Are there major differences between the 36 and 34?
lterry
07-16-2006, 06:43 AM
The major difference between the 36 and the 34 is the ATA length. :D
The Elite 34 is 2 inches shorter than the Elite 36....the reason we came out with the Elite 34 and the Elite 32 was so many archers wanted shorter ATA length bows. :) As we all know the longer the ATA the more forgiving the bow.

and have a Nice Newberry Sabre XL just hanging on the wall, I just can't get use to the low let off with it
Don't they have a mod that you can change for the let off? The one thing I like about my Alpine Fatal Impacts...besides the fact that it's solo...is that not only can I adjust the DL in 1/2 inch increments (from 27-31inches)...but you can easily change from the standard 80% let off to 65% and back just by switching out a module. Since it's for hunting, I usually have the 65% mod in it...anyhow...it's very adjustable...and easliy adjustable...all without a bow press.
